本标准与引用标准及国标相近牌号对照表
表A.2 Q/BQB 610-2004 DIN17100-80 EN10025:1990 prEN10025-2:1998 GB/T 3274-88
S185 St33 Fe310-0 S185 Q195,Q215A,Q215B
S235JR St37-2 Fe360B S235JR Q235B
S275JR St44-2 Fe430B S275JR Q255B
S355JR - Fe510B S355JR Q345B,Q390B
牌号为S235JR、S275JR和 S355JR的成品化学成分应符合表3的规定,供方如能保证,可不进行成品分析
牌 号 公称厚度 mm 化 学 成 分 (熔 炼 分 析) %
C Si Mn P S 其 它
S235JR 5~40 ≤0.19 - ≤1.50 ≤0.040 ≤0.040 N≤0.014
S235JR >40~150 ≤0.23 - ≤1.50 ≤0.040 ≤0.040 N≤0.014
S275JR 5~40 ≤0.24 - ≤1.60 ≤0.040 ≤0.040 N≤0.014
S275JR >40~150 ≤0.25 - ≤1.60 ≤0.040 ≤0.040 N≤0.014
S355JR 5~150 ≤0.27 ≤0.60 ≤1.70 ≤0.040 ≤0.040 N≤0.014
牌号为S235JR、S275JR和 S355JR的碳当量应符合表4的规定。
表4 牌号 碳当量Ceqa, % ≤
厚度,mm
S235JR ≤40 >40~150
S235JR 0.35 0.38
S275JR 0.40 0.42
S355JR 0.45 0.47
根据熔炼分析来计算碳当量
根据以上数据,两种钢如果用于一般结构件,可以代用。特殊情况除外。肯定不是不锈钢下载本文
